So, to that end, you can run vagrant up
and by default it will run
two vagrant instances - one master, one slave.
You can control that by MESOS_SLAVES
environment variable. So to
spin up 3 slaves, MESOS_SLAVES=3 vagrant up
It is all managed by deployment-profiles.cfg
-- your standard python
based configParser with interpolation.
test
- No production deployments without test code
validate
- pylint, flake8 for python and eventually PMD and FindBugs
for Java
deploy
- for actually running. Running locally is really just deploy
with --env local
which is default
package
- Packages files in projects/{java,python} repos
history
- Starts/Stops the history server
- Quark is not a build system -- it commands other build systems to do stuff
